在区块链技术快速发展的今天,Layer2智能合约作为一种新兴的技术,正逐渐改变着加密交易的速度和成本。Layer2智能合约是建立在Layer1(如以太坊)之上的第二层解决方案,它通过优化交易流程,极大地提升了交易速度和降低了交易成本。本文将深入探讨Layer2智能合约的工作原理、优势以及其在加密交易中的应用。
Layer2智能合约:什么是它?
Layer2智能合约是在Layer1区块链之上运行的一层协议,它通过将部分计算和存储任务转移到Layer2上,来减轻Layer1的压力,从而提高交易速度和降低成本。Layer2智能合约通常包括以下几种类型:
状态通道(State Channels):通过预先建立的状态通道,用户可以在不经过Layer1的情况下进行交易,只有在通道关闭时才将最终状态提交到Layer1。
侧链(Sidechains):侧链是一个独立的区块链,但与主链(Layer1)有交互。侧链上的交易可以在主链上验证,从而实现跨链交易。
状态树(State Trees):通过使用Merkle证明等技术,将交易状态存储在Layer2上,从而提高交易速度。
Layer2智能合约的优势
Layer2智能合约具有以下优势:
提高交易速度:由于Layer2智能合约将部分计算和存储任务转移到Layer2上,因此可以显著提高交易速度。
降低交易成本:Layer2智能合约的交易成本通常远低于Layer1,因为Layer2上的交易量更大,可以共享资源。
提高可扩展性:Layer2智能合约可以减轻Layer1的压力,从而提高整个区块链系统的可扩展性。
增强用户体验:由于交易速度和成本的降低,用户可以获得更好的交易体验。
Layer2智能合约的应用
Layer2智能合约在加密交易领域具有广泛的应用,以下是一些典型的应用场景:
去中心化金融(DeFi):Layer2智能合约可以用于构建去中心化金融应用,如借贷、交易、衍生品等。
游戏和NFT:Layer2智能合约可以用于构建去中心化游戏和NFT平台,提高游戏和NFT的流转速度。
支付和结算:Layer2智能合约可以用于构建快速、低成本的支付和结算系统。
身份验证和隐私保护:Layer2智能合约可以用于构建去中心化身份验证和隐私保护解决方案。
案例分析:Optimism和Arbitrum
Optimism和Arbitrum是两个知名的Layer2智能合约平台,以下是它们的一些特点:
Optimism:Optimism使用Rollup技术,将交易数据打包到Layer2上,然后在Layer1上验证。Optimism支持以太坊虚拟机(EVM),因此可以运行以太坊上的所有智能合约。
Arbitrum:Arbitrum同样使用Rollup技术,但与Optimism不同,Arbitrum使用一种称为“Arbitrum One”的优化机制,以提高交易速度和降低成本。
总结
Layer2智能合约作为一种新兴的技术,正逐渐改变着加密交易的速度和成本。通过优化交易流程,Layer2智能合约为用户提供了更快、更低成本的交易体验。随着Layer2智能合约技术的不断发展和完善,我们有理由相信,它将在未来发挥更加重要的作用。
